|
|
|
Пара базовых вопросов по сетям в Linux + VirtualBox
|
|||
|---|---|---|---|
|
#18+
Всем привет! Прошу помочь. Сорри что вопросы неинтересные, наверное, просто в Linux плохо разбираюсь :/ Я настраиваю виртуальную сеть. У меня есть 3 VirtualBox с Debian внутри Windows host. Использую NAT + Virtual Host-Only Adapter на всех. Все пингуется. Однако я не понимаю несколько вещей. 1) Когда я делал 2ю и 3ю виртуалки я их клонировал. В итоге когда я вызываю uname -a или hostname у меня там имя первой виртуалки. Как это поменять? На что это влияет? 2) Я хочу обращаться к нодам по имени хоста. Что мне для этого нужно сделать? Я прописал такую штуку в /etc/hosts: Код: plaintext Код: plaintext Что не так? В чем различие между ping <someHost> и host <someHost>? 3) Мой Virtual Host-Only Adapter имеет свой адрес: 192.168.137.1. Этот же адрес я присвоил gateway в /etc/network/interfaces и nameserver в /etc/resolv.conf. Это верно? 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 21.02.2015, 00:35 |
|
||
|
Пара базовых вопросов по сетям в Linux + VirtualBox
|
|||
|---|---|---|---|
|
#18+
Интересно, что после перезагрузки ОноСамо проставляет nameserver в /etc/resolv.conf и ставит туда адрес DNS сервера моего провайдера! Вполне логично что через него мой собственный локальный хост debianThird не резолвится. Как же быть? С другой стороны, ошибка которая вылезает говорит что вообще нельзя соединиться, а не not resolved. Непонятно.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 21.02.2015, 00:42 |
|
||
|
Пара базовых вопросов по сетям в Linux + VirtualBox
|
|||
|---|---|---|---|
|
#18+
1. В конфигах ОС (точно не скажу, где именно). Влияет, например, на ответ на вопрос "ой, на какую это машину я залогинился?" 2. DNS, который должен резолвить эти имена, не настроен, вероятно. Или прописан не тот сервер доменных имён (например, провайдерский вместо локального). 3. Зависит от схемы сети. Если хост 192.168.137.1 умеет пересылать пакеты в другие сети (раздавать интернет и т.п.) и обрабатывать (или пересылать дальше) запросы к DNS - то вполне.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 21.02.2015, 22:34 |
|
||
|
Пара базовых вопросов по сетям в Linux + VirtualBox
|
|||
|---|---|---|---|
|
#18+
vkle, спасибо за попытку помочь! Скажите, а я вообще могу обойтись без DNS сервера во внутренней сети? Для доступа в инет нужен DNS. Однако он может быть любым внешним. Но нужен ли DNS сервер для того чтобы резолвить хосты внутри сети? Я думал, что запись в etc/hosts его заменяет. Или надо настроить что-то еще дополнительно к этой записи? 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 26.02.2015, 10:57 |
|
||
|
Пара базовых вопросов по сетям в Linux + VirtualBox
|
|||
|---|---|---|---|
|
#18+
DymytryНо нужен ли DNS сервер для того чтобы резолвить хосты внутри сети? Я думал, что запись в etc/hosts его заменяет.Отчасти да. Однако, некоторые программы используют именно ДНС, игнорируя записи в hosts. И ещё, когда в сети машин более одной, а резолвинг локальных имён требуется - то с ДНС жить гораздо проще. ИМХО конечно. DymytryСкажите, а я вообще могу обойтись без DNS сервера во внутренней сети?Обойдётесь или нет - не знаю. Зависит от Ваших потребностей. Попробуйте отказаться от доменных имён и обращайтесь непосредственно по IP-адресу - возможно, это Вас устроит. DymytryДля доступа в инет нужен DNS.Ну... до 1984 года как-то обходились. :) 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 26.02.2015, 13:47 |
|
||
|
Пара базовых вопросов по сетям в Linux + VirtualBox
|
|||
|---|---|---|---|
|
#18+
В принципе, если локальный ДНС по какой-то причине поднимать нецелесообразно или просто лениво, то можно использовать какой-то "интернетовский" сервер (например, ДНС хостинг-провайдера). Только имена в этом случае будут вида myhost-1.mydomain.com . Не уверен, но можно попробовать прописать в resolv.conf строчку "search mydomain.com" для обращения по коротким именам вида "myhost-1". 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 26.02.2015, 20:30 |
|
||
|
Пара базовых вопросов по сетям в Linux + VirtualBox
|
|||
|---|---|---|---|
|
#18+
vkleВ принципе, если локальный ДНС по какой-то причине поднимать нецелесообразно или просто лениво, то можно использовать какой-то "интернетовский" сервер (например, ДНС хостинг-провайдера). Только имена в этом случае будут вида myhost-1.mydomain.com . Так я это и хочу! Вот только как это сделать. Я попытался задать резолв хоста через 192.168.137.13 debianThird.debian.com debianThird в etc/hosts, но это не работает. Может, дело в том что при таком подходе в адресе всегда будет имя хоста? myHostName.mydomain.com, вне зависимости от настроек etc/hosts? Но имя хоста-то у меня одно из-за копи-паста виртуалок. Еще не могу понять почему ping резолвит хосты, а host - нет :/ 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 26.02.2015, 23:23 |
|
||
|
Пара базовых вопросов по сетям в Linux + VirtualBox
|
|||
|---|---|---|---|
|
#18+
Dymytryв etc/hosts, но это не работает Dymytryне могу понять почему ping резолвит хосты, а host - нет man host После прочтения первой строчки будет понятно. Надеюсь :-) 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 26.02.2015, 23:34 |
|
||
|
|

start [/forum/topic.php?fid=25&msg=38885495&tid=1482173]: |
0ms |
get settings: |
9ms |
get forum list: |
15ms |
check forum access: |
3ms |
check topic access: |
3ms |
track hit: |
170ms |
get topic data: |
9ms |
get forum data: |
2ms |
get page messages: |
41ms |
get tp. blocked users: |
1ms |
| others: | 238ms |
| total: | 491ms |

| 0 / 0 |

Извините, этот баннер — требование Роскомнадзора для исполнения 152 ФЗ.
«На сайте осуществляется обработка файлов cookie, необходимых для работы сайта, а также для анализа использования сайта и улучшения предоставляемых сервисов с использованием метрической программы Яндекс.Метрика. Продолжая использовать сайт, вы даёте согласие с использованием данных технологий».
... ля, ля, ля ...